Time & Material Support Terms of Service
Revised: December 2025
Overview of Service
Digital Service provides website support on a time and material (T&M) basis when a campus unit is unable to commit to a full-service MOU agreement. As the name implies, the T&M service allows a website to be maintained in a manner that will allow for the greatest amount of uptime for the website with a low level of proactive management from Digital Service. In order to properly manage university resources, those websites relying upon T&M service will be addressed only after all MOU websites are maintained and may experience downtime or reliability issues due to that.
Required Maintenance
All campus units are obligated to ensure that websites and their technology abide by university standards for hosting and security. The following tasks will be completed on all websites without requiring prior authorization and will incur a minimum 1/2 hour charge per month:
- Content Management System (CMS) security patches and upgrades – upon notification by the CMS vendor/community of a required upgrade or patch to the core CMS system, Digital Service will apply those patches/upgrades and remediate issues that arise.
- Third party CMS theme security patches and upgrades – upon notification by the theme vendor/community of a required upgrade or patch, Digital Service will apply those patches/upgrades and remediate issues that arise.
- Plugin/module security patches and upgrades – upon notification by the plugin/module vendor/community of a new version or patch, Digital Service will apply the updates and remediate issues that arise.
- Backups – As part of the website cloud hosting service, Digital Service provides daily and other backups to hosted websites.
- Website storage – Periodically, websites require additional space for various reasons during their lifecycle. In these situations, Digital Service will add space in increments of 5GB and adjust database and storage settings to ensure that the websites do not succumb to critical errors due to running out of space. Campus units will be notified after the fact of the action(s) required and hosting charges will be adjusted based upon published rates at the time of the incident.
Optional Maintenance
- Campus units who have chosen T&M support may make requests for website changes and fixes by submitting a request to Digital Service (see Requesting Support below). In these situations, a tracking task is created in our work request system and a web developer is assigned the ticket. An estimate will be provided to the campus unit before work is started if the task is expected to exceed five (5) hours in duration. Otherwise, the work will be completed and billed as requested.
Mizzou Base Theme
When a website uses the Mizzou Base Theme to provide a look and feel that is consistent with the university’s identity and branding requirements, Digital Service will ensure that the theme and its underlying technology is kept on the most current, supported version. Digital Service will apply updates when such updates are determined to be important for security or usability considerations as with third party themes (above). In these cases, Digital Service will provide the department with an early indication of upcoming theme updates and provide an estimate of what the cost will be before proceeding to update the theme. Theme updates are pre-approved expenses for all T&M customers.
Paying for T&M Service
All campus units making use of the T&M service are required to provide Digital Service a single MoCode and the name of the account’s authorized signer. Hours are billed monthly via the Division of IT’s Deployed Services billing portal. There is a ½ hour minimum for all T&M work performed by Digital Service.
Campus units are also required to provide at least one authorized contact for the website(s) being hosted and supported by Digital Service. We require the name, email address, office and after-hours phone numbers for our records.
